Abstract

A novel fluorescent dye named ATTO 390 is tested and verified to be applicable in STED microscopy with great performance. The experimental configuration uses a 405nm continuous wave (CW) laser as excitation beam and a 532nm CW laser as depletion beam. The two collinear beams are focused on the dye using an objective with NA=1.4 and the fluorescence is detected by avalanche photodiode detector. With short wavelength in violet band, high fluorescence quantum yield, good photostability, and relatively low Ps demonstrated in a series of experiments, ATTO 390 is proved to be a potential good choice for fluorescent dye in STED microscopy.
